About Scotland’s Gardens Scheme Open Garden: Maggie’s Glasgow

If you, or someone you love, has been diagnosed with cancer, Maggie’s is here for you. Our centres are built in the grounds of hospitals, near to the NHS cancer centre. In every centre, you’ll find a bright and welcoming space full of the kind of support that people facing cancer need and deserve.

Our centre in Glasgow is a striking, single storey building, designed by Rem Koolhaas. It is formed as a ring shape around a landscaped internal courtyard and is nestled among the woodland in the grounds of Gartnavel Hospital. The centre is a space for being together or for a moment alone, for getting going again or for meeting people who just get it. Our Cancer Support Specialists have expert knowledge about cancer and treatment. No appointment or referral is necessary, just come in. As well as expert support and guidance we also run a programme of therapeutic classes, workshops and courses. All our support is free. Lily Jencks, daughter of Maggie’s co-founders, Maggie Keswick Jencks and Charles Jencks, designed the internal courtyard plantings and the wooded glades areas surrounding the centre. 'Everything has been designed to show an enthusiasm for life and you need that when you’re fighting cancer – you need something to give you a bit of life and power.' Lily Jencks
